Understanding the perception of fear of crime and harassment on Swiss public trains

Perceived risks and fear of crime on public transport impact the travel experiences and choices of customers.

Brief information

School:

Social Work

Status:

Completed

Period:

01.08.2021 - 31.12.2022

Overview

This project aims to collect rich data about fears and experiences of crime of diverse groups. It will further evaluate existing interventions regarding train travel and explore reporting behaviour with regards to assault, aggression and harassment. An in-depth understanding of the fear of crime and experiences of harassment of train travellers of all genders remains an urgent field for research and action in Switzerland. The project aims to develop a more in-depth understanding of the concrete fears and experiences of customers and their gendered dimension, evaluate existing measures and interventions, and formulate recommendations that improve the train travel experiences of customers and increase the reporting of assault, aggression and harassment.
